Panshi

Explain unfamiliar code in plain English

Turn a dense, clever, or cryptic snippet into a clear explanation a human can follow — line by line where it matters.

Some code is hard to read because it is bad, and some is hard because it is dense with intent: a clever one-liner, a regex, a bitwise trick, a chained reduce. Either way, the gap between "I see the characters" and "I understand the idea" can stall a whole task.

This tool closes that gap. Paste the snippet and it explains what it does and why, breaking down the tricky lines step by step. It is ideal for code review, onboarding, or just decoding the clever thing a previous engineer left behind.

The tool for this

🧩Legacy Code Explainer

Paste unfamiliar code and get a plain-English walkthrough, data flow and risks.

Try Legacy Code Explainer →

Frequently asked questions

Can it explain a regex or one-liner? +

Yes. Dense expressions like regexes, bitwise operations and chained calls are exactly what it breaks down step by step.

Is it good for code review? +

Yes — it helps reviewers understand unfamiliar changes faster so they can focus on correctness rather than decoding syntax.

How detailed is the explanation? +

It gives a high-level summary plus line-by-line detail on the parts that are genuinely tricky.

Related tools

Browse the full tools directory, or see all Panshi services.